Locate the electrical source


Prior to inviting your plumbing professionals over, ensure that there is a power outlet near your preferred dish washer location. If there isn't, you might need to run a cord to that place. These tiny mistakes can make or mar your experience, so you would succeed to check ahead of time.
You can use this possibility to inspect that your cooking area has an independent control to ensure that you can shut off the kitchen area's power at once while taking pleasure in power in the rest of your house. This simple fixture can protect against several crashes and conserve you some money.

Make certain the parts are total


If you're acquiring a low-cost dish washer, opportunities are that the parts aren't total. You can check the info provided regarding the item to verify. If it isn't, you might need to shop for parts with your plumber. Check for a consumption hose, a power cord or perhaps a heavy steam nozzle.
There is a significant possibility of getting dissimilar parts, so seek advice from a person with a lot of experience, simply put, your emergency plumbing professionals.

Check your water shut-off shutoff


Your dish washer will have its own connection. It might be attached to your kitchen sink's supply, or it might have its very own fixtures from your primary. However, you need to understand that you can regulate the water that provides your new dishwashing machine.
While planning for the installation, shut off all links to the cooking area. This can prevent mishaps and also disturbances.
Checking your shut-off valve prior to your plumber gets here can additionally prevent you from unforeseen costs due to the fact that you can't connect a new dishwashing machine to a damaged shut down valve.
Also ensure that there are no cross links that can stop your dish washer from getting hot water.

    How to plan for installing a dishwasher in your kitchen


    Figure out the location of the machine


    The main thing you will need to be sure about when it comes to the location of your dishwasher is that the machine will be able to be connected to both water and waste pipes. If these aren’t present in your designated choice of location, then you will have to decide on somewhere else to put it or call in a plumber. Most dishwashers only require a cold water supply though.



    The best place to put a dishwasher is against an exterior wall, as this way you won’t require a waste pipe running the length of your house. You will also want it placed onto a firm, flat floor to cope with any vibrations or movements.



    Most people also make sure that their dishwasher is located next to the sink, so that plates and dishes can be easily transferred to the machine. If you don’t have space in your kitchen for a dishwasher – why not try re-locating your washing machine to a garage or cellar?



    Standard dishwashers require at least a 24-inch (60cm) wide opening to make sure that there is enough space for the machine to fit easy. Those who are installing a dishwasher in their kitchen for the very first time will also need to make sure that they have drilled holes for water inlets, a drainage tube and for the electrical wires which come with the device.


    Linking up to a power supply


    If you don’t have any electrical sockets nearby for your dishwasher, then you will have to call in a qualified electrician to do this.



    Most of the time, dishwashers will run off their own circuit, however you can alternatively tie it in to your current kitchen circuit. You will have to check this with your local building codes however, as this is prohibited in some situations.


    Preparing the dishwasher cabinet


    As well as these main issues, you will also have to think about the cabinet that is going to hold your dishwasher. The first thing you will need to do is paint the inside with moisture-proof paint, as this will prevent any build-up of build-up of mildew that could result from the steam.



    You will then need to decide if you want a door for the cabinet to match with the other units in your kitchen and keep it tucked away. You could also try a piece of fabric covering the appliance, which some may prefer stylistically. This last option could also be cheaper.
